Key IIOSC Statistics You Need to Know
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. What are some of the most important IIOSC statistics you should be familiar with? We're going to cover some of the key metrics that can significantly impact your financial decisions. First up, we have market capitalization, or "market cap." This is the total value of a company's outstanding shares. It's a quick way to gauge the size and potential of a company. Knowing the market cap can help you evaluate a company's risk and growth potential. Next, we have trading volume, which measures the number of shares traded over a specific period. High trading volume often indicates increased interest in a stock, while low volume could signal a lack of interest or liquidity issues. Pay close attention to these signals, as they can reveal underlying market sentiment. Price-to-earnings (P/E) ratios are another critical metric. This ratio compares a company's stock price to its earnings per share. It helps you determine whether a stock is overvalued, undervalued, or fairly priced. A high P/E ratio might suggest that investors have high expectations for future growth, while a low P/E ratio could indicate that a stock is potentially undervalued. This is also important because it can tell you if the company is in a good financial position.
We will also be exploring other essential metrics, like dividend yields, which show the return on investment from dividends paid by a company. Dividend yields can be a crucial factor for income-seeking investors. Furthermore, we'll delve into financial ratios, like the debt-to-equity ratio, which provides insights into a company's financial leverage. This can tell you how much a company relies on debt versus equity to finance its operations. Understanding these ratios can help you assess a company's financial health and stability. We'll also examine the concept of volatility, which measures the degree of price fluctuations over a given period. Volatility is an essential consideration for assessing risk, and it can impact your investment strategies. Resources and Tools for Analyzing IIOSC Statistics
Where do you find all these amazing IIOSC statistics, you ask? Don't worry, we've got you covered. There are plenty of resources and tools available to help you analyze and interpret this valuable data. First and foremost, you can check out financial websites, such as Yahoo Finance, Google Finance, and Bloomberg. These platforms provide a wealth of information, including real-time stock quotes, financial news, and detailed IIOSC statistics. They also offer tools for charting, portfolio tracking, and financial analysis. These are great starting points for your research. Next, consider using financial data providers like Refinitiv and FactSet. These providers offer comprehensive data and analytical tools used by professionals. While they can be pricey, they provide in-depth analysis and reporting capabilities. They're great for serious investors who want the most detailed data. You could also try investment research platforms such as Morningstar and Seeking Alpha. These platforms offer investment ratings, research reports, and analysis from expert analysts. They can provide valuable insights into specific stocks, sectors, and market trends. These platforms offer a great way to stay informed and make data-driven decisions.
Then, there are software and spreadsheets. Many investors use software, like Excel or Google Sheets, to create their own models and analyze IIOSC statistics. You can import data from various sources and create custom dashboards to track your portfolio's performance. This gives you greater control over your analysis.
